الملخص EN

An overview of recent advances in electromechanical impedance- (EMI-) based structural health monitoring is presented in this paper.

The basic principle of the EMI method is to use high-frequency excitation to sense the local area of a structure.

Changes in impedance indicate changes in the structure, which in turn indicate that damages appear.

An accurate EMI model based on the method of reverberation-ray matrix is introduced to correlate changes in the signatures to physical parameters of structures for damage detection.

Comparison with other numerical results and experimental data validates the present model.

A brief remark of the feasibility of implementing the EMI method is considered and the effects of some physical parameters on EMI technique are also discussed.
